예제 #1
0
 def test_run_no_delete(self):
     config = clcommon.config.update_option(self.config,
         'clblob.benchmark.delete_threads', 0)
     benchmark = clblob.benchmark.Benchmark(config)
     benchmark.run()
     self.assertTrue('delete' not in benchmark.results)
     for method in ['get', 'put']:
         self.assertEquals(1, benchmark.results[method]['threads'])
         self.assertEquals(10, benchmark.results[method]['calls'])
 def test_run_no_delete(self):
     config = clcommon.config.update_option(
         self.config, 'clblob.benchmark.delete_threads', 0)
     benchmark = clblob.benchmark.Benchmark(config)
     benchmark.run()
     self.assertTrue('delete' not in benchmark.results)
     for method in ['get', 'put']:
         self.assertEquals(1, benchmark.results[method]['threads'])
         self.assertEquals(10, benchmark.results[method]['calls'])
예제 #3
0
 def test_run(self):
     benchmark = clblob.benchmark.Benchmark(self.config)
     benchmark.run()
     for method in ['delete', 'get', 'put']:
         self.assertEquals(1, benchmark.results[method]['threads'])
         self.assertEquals(10, benchmark.results[method]['calls'])
 def test_run(self):
     benchmark = clblob.benchmark.Benchmark(self.config)
     benchmark.run()
     for method in ['delete', 'get', 'put']:
         self.assertEquals(1, benchmark.results[method]['threads'])
         self.assertEquals(10, benchmark.results[method]['calls'])